I just had the same problem (this is actually the 3rd or 4th time in fact). I'm running Windows 7 and Firefox 8. While I don't have a fix for the problem (i.e. the cause), I do have a solution that seemed to work for me.

  1. Open taskmgr.
  2. End process tree for "firefox.exe" (I know, it doesn't work but do this step anyway.)
  3. End process tree for "explorer.exe" (this will make your screen blank except for your wallpaper since you just killed windows explorer.)
  4. ctrl+alt+delete and re-open taskmgr.
  5. Click "File" -> "New Task (Run...)"
  6. In the field to the right of "Open:", type "explorer"
  7. Click "OK" (or, press enter)

This will restart windows explorer and when I re-opened taskmgr, Firefox was no longer listed and I was able to restart Firefox.
